# Bentonville Flock Finance Records
The Finance package supplies the municipal authorization, billing, and payment trail absent from the first release.
## Reconciled transactions
| Purpose | Purchase order | Invoice | Payment |
|---|---|---|---|
| Police: five Flex LPRs, year one | `22505365`, 2025-10-10, `$25,000` | `INV-76339`, 2025-10-07, `$25,000` | check `258982`, 2025-10-30, `$25,000` |
| Parks: original sixteen-camera deployment | `22403431`, `$56,040` | `INV-60724`, `$56,040` | check `254116`, 2025-04-17, `$56,040` |
| Parks: five-camera expansion | `22501643`, `$18,750` | `INV-61487`, reduced after a `$5,000` installation-delay concession | check `257447`, 2025-08-28, `$14,106.25` |
| Parks: original sixteen-camera renewal | `22506068`, `$48,000` | `INV-77997`, `$48,000` | check `259675`, `$48,000` |
| Parks: later six-camera arrangement | `22601327`, 2026-03-06, `$22,500` | not in this package | not in this package |
The amounts and identifiers are quoted from the named purchase-order, invoice, and check files. The package has no separate invoice or check tied to PO `22601327`.
## Significance
The Police chain resolves the first production's missing-procurement gap: the five LPRs were subject to an executed `$75,000` subscription, and Finance paid the `$25,000` first-year amount ([[Bentonville Police Flock Agreement]]).
The Parks chains establish payment for the original deployment, the discounted expansion, and the first renewal. They do not reconcile the contract quantities to the current eighteen-site native inventory ([[T053 - Bentonville Ordered PTZ Quantities vs Current Eighteen-Site Inventory]]).
